如何通过计算机名或IP地址访问共享资源

2025-09-26

摘要:在数字化协作日益普及的今天,局域网内的资源共享已成为团队高效运转的核心需求。无论是通过计算机名还是IP地址访问共享资源,其本质在于建立设备间的可信连接与权限分配。这一过程不仅...

在数字化协作日益普及的今天,局域网内的资源共享已成为团队高效运转的核心需求。无论是通过计算机名还是IP地址访问共享资源,其本质在于建立设备间的可信连接与权限分配。这一过程不仅涉及网络协议的基础原理,还需结合操作系统特性与安全策略进行综合配置。

访问机制解析

计算机名与IP地址的本质差异决定了不同的访问机制。计算机名依赖NetBIOS协议实现局域网内设备发现,其工作原理类似于电话簿查询——当用户输入计算机名时,系统会通过广播或WINS服务器查找对应的IP地址。这种机制的优势在于便于记忆,但可能因IPv6优先解析导致访问失败。

IP地址访问则绕过了名称解析环节,直接通过TCP/IP协议建立连接。例如输入192.168.1.100时,系统会跳过DNS查询步骤,直接向目标IP发起SMB协议通信。根据微软技术文档,这种方式的访问效率更高,但要求用户必须预先知晓目标设备的准确IP地址。

操作流程详解

通过IP地址访问共享资源时,用户需在文件资源管理器的地址栏输入格式为IPv4地址的路径。若目标设备已开启共享且防火墙放行,系统将列出所有共享目录。例如访问192.168.1.100project时,斜杠后的路径对应具体共享文件夹名称。若仅输入IP地址,则会显示该设备所有开放共享的列表。

计算机名访问需确保网络发现功能已启用。在Windows系统中,需通过控制面板启用"SMB 1.0/CIFS客户端"功能,并在高级共享设置中开启网络发现。当出现解析错误时,可尝试在hosts文件中手动绑定计算机名与IP地址,格式如192.168.1.100 PC-01。

权限管理体系

共享资源的访问权限由双重机制控制:共享权限与NTFS权限。共享权限通过文件夹属性的"共享"选项卡设置,支持为不同用户分配读取、更改或完全控制权限。实验数据显示,当共享权限与NTFS权限冲突时,系统会采用两者中最严格的权限。

在域环境中,建议采用基于AD账户的权限分配。例如为财务部门创建AD组,赋予其对共享文件夹的修改权限,而非使用默认的Everyone账户。对于敏感数据,可启用SMB 3.0加密功能,该技术采用AES-128加密算法,能有效防止中间人攻击。

故障诊断策略

当出现"找不到网络路径"错误时,需按层级排查。首先确认目标设备的TCP/IP NetBIOS Helper服务是否运行,该服务负责维护NetBIOS名称表。其次检查防火墙设置,确保"文件和打印机共享"规则已放行。若使用计算机名访问失败但IP地址可连接,往往是DNS解析异常,可通过ipconfig /flushdns命令刷新缓存。

对于Windows 10及以上系统特有的访问问题,可能需要调整注册表项。例如在HKEY_LOCAL_MACHINESYSTEMCurrentControlSetServicesLanmanWorkstationParameters中,新建AllowInsecureGuestAuth值为1的DWORD项,可解决部分认证失败问题。

安全增强建议

企业级部署应启用802.1X网络认证,结合MAC地址绑定策略。定期审核共享文件夹的访问日志,可通过事件查看器筛选ID为5140的审核事件,监控异常访问行为。对于跨网段访问需求,建议配置站点到站点的IPsec VPN隧道,而非直接暴露共享服务到公网。

相关推荐